FOREWORD

This Operation & Maintenance Manual was written to give the owner / operator instructions on the safe operation and maintenance of the Bobcat utility vehicle. READ AND UNDERSTAND THIS OPERATION & MAINTENANCE MANUAL BEFORE OPERATING YOUR BOBCAT UTILITY VEHICLE. If you have any questions, see your Bobcat dealer. This manual may illustrate options and accessories not installed on your Bobcat utility vehicle

S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S
Before Operation

  • Carefully follow the operating and maintenance instructions in this manual. The Bobcat utility vehicle is highly maneuverable and compact. It is rugged and useful under a wide variety of conditions.
  • This presents an operator with hazards associated with off road, rough terrain applications, common with Bobcat utility vehicle usage. This vehicle handles differently than other vehicles, such as motorcycles, golf cars or cars. If you fail to take proper precautions, a collision or rollover can occur quickly, even during routine maneuvers like turning, braking, driving over rough terrain and up and down hills or over obstacles.
  • This can result in severe injury or death. This vehicle is intended for off road use only and should not be operated on public roads. Driving this vehicle in an aggressive manner can increase the risk of head injury and requires head protection. For these aggressive driving conditions, Bobcat Company recommends that all occupants wear a properly fitting Department of Transportation (D.O.T.) approved helmet

Always follow these instructions:

  •  Fasten seat belts for occupant restraint before operating.
  • Keep hands and feet inside the vehicle at all times.
  • Travel at appropriate vehicle speeds depending on the type of terrain, visibility conditions, operating conditions and your operating experience.
  • Wear eye protection.
  • Wear other personal protective equipment such as a helmet or hard hat, face protection, hearing protection, safety boots or shoes, chemical suit, respirators and gloves as needed by work location and vehicle operation.
  • NEVER attempt jumps or other stunts with the vehicle.

This vehicle is an ADULT VEHICLE ONLY. NEVER operate this vehicle if you are under age 16 and NEVER operate without a valid drivers license. No person under the age of 12 may ride as a passenger in this vehicle.

  • Any passenger must be able to comfortably reach the floor and hand holds. Never permit a guest to operate this vehicle unless the guest has read this manual and all safety signs (decals). Always inspect the vehicle before each use to make sure it is in safe operating condition. Always follow the inspection procedures described in this manual.
  • The Bobcat utility vehicle has an internal combustion engine with resultant heat and exhaust. All exhaust gases can kill or cause illness so use the utility vehicle with adequate ventilation. The dealer explains the capabilities and restrictions of the Bobcat utility vehicle, attachment and accessories for each application. The dealer demonstrates the safe operation according to Bobcat instructional materials, which are also available to operators.
  • The dealer can also identify unsafe modifications or use of unapproved attachments and accessories. The attachments and buckets are designed for an attachment arm Rated Capacity. They are designed for secure fastening to the Bobcat utility vehicle. The user must check with the dealer, or Bobcat literature, to determine safe loads of materials of specified densities for the vehicle – attachment combination.

The following publications and training materials provide information on the safe use and maintenance of the Bobcat utility vehicle and attachments and accessories:

  • • The Delivery Report is used to assure that complete instructions have been given to the new owner and that the machine and attachment is in safe operating condition.
  • The Operation & Maintenance Manual delivered with the machine or attachment gives operating information as well as routine maintenance and service procedures. It is a part of the machine and can be stored in a container provided on the machine. Replacement Operation & Maintenance Manuals can be ordered from your Bobcat dealer.
  • Machine signs (decals) instruct on the safe operation and care of your Bobcat machine or attachment. The signs and their locations are shown in the Operation & Maintenance Manual. Replacement signs are available from your Bobcat dealer.
  • An Operator’s Handbook is fastened to the operator cab of the machine. It’s brief instructions are convenient to the operator. The handbook is available from your dealer in an English edition or one of many other languages. See your Bobcat dealer for more information on translated versions.
  • The Toolcat Utility Work Machine Operating Training Course is available through your Bobcat dealer. This course is intended to provide rules and practices of correct operation of the Toolcat utility work machine. The course is available in English and Spanish versions.
